Definition of undissolved - Reverso English Dictionary
Adjective
1.
metaphoricalRare remaining unresolved or intactRare
- The undissolved issues caused tension in the meeting.
2.
chemistryTECH. retaining a solid form without dissolvingTECH.
- The undissolved salt was visible at the bottom of the glass.
Origin of undissolved
Latin, dis- (apart) + solvere (to loosen)
Examples of undissolved in a sentence
His undissolved anger was evident in his harsh words. The solution was cloudy due to undissolved particles. Undissolved sugar settled at the bottom of the cup.
